Push Ad Pricing: What You Need to Know
Understanding mobile ad rates can feel challenging, but this doesn’t have to be hard. Generally, you’ll find a few common approaches regarding allocating for these campaigns. A dominant form is Cost-Per-Install (CPI) meaning you spend a predetermined sum for one fresh app download. Besides, Cost-Per-Action (CPA) centers on specific user actions, like creating an account or completing a transaction, then allocate just when said results happen. Lastly, some services offer Cost-Per-Click (CPC) whereby you receive a charge each occasion a user taps your promotion.
- CPI - Cost per installation
- CPA - Cost per action
- CPC - Cost per click

Desktop Traffic Acquisition: Costs & Strategies
Acquiring users through desktop channels remains a key component of many advertising strategies, but understanding the associated expenses and effective tactics is imperative. The price of desktop traffic differs greatly depending on the method employed. Paid promotions , such as Google Ads or Bing Ads, generally involve a CPC model, where you are charged for each visit on your ad . This can range from a few pennies to several euros, or even more, based on competition . Organic users, obtained through Search Engine Optimization (SEO) and content marketing , requires a significant investment in time and popunder ads for new websites resources . Consider a breakdown of common strategies:
- SEO: Focusing on keyword research, online presence optimization, and inbound links – potentially yielding free, long-term audience.
- Paid Advertising: Leveraging platforms like Google Ads to reach targeted audiences – offering quick results but with a immediate monetary outlay.
- Content Marketing: Creating informative blog articles and other materials to attract and retain potential customers.
- Email Marketing: Building an email list and sending promotional messages – relatively a cost-effective method to drive ongoing traffic.
Ultimately, results in desktop traffic acquisition copyrights on a strategic methodology that balances investment with potential benefits.
Understanding Popunder Advertising Costs in 2024
Popunder promotion costs in 2024 are proving a tricky subject for businesses. Unlike standard digital platforms , pricing isn’t always predictable . Typically, you'll encounter costs based on either a Cost per thousand model (price per one thousand displays) or a Pay Per Click structure. CPM rates for popunders are often lower than traditional advertising, falling anywhere from $0.50 to $3.00, based on factors like target audience, regional location, and promotional quality. CPC costs tend to be somewhat higher, maybe between $0.10 and $1.00 per click .
However, several other considerations affect the total expense. These include:
- Ad Network Choice : Different agencies have unique pricing structures .
- Traffic Quality: Higher quality engagement from desirable groups will fetch a higher price.
- Ad Design: Effective ads typically generate better performance , potentially justifying increased bids.
- Competition : greater competition for targeted audiences will drive up pricing.
